Top 10 Best Selling & Top 10 Worst Selling SUVs Of All Sizes in July 2023

Written By: Jerry Reynolds | Aug 7, 2023 8:00:09 PM

SUVs continued their roll last month, racking up over 400,000 sales versus July 2022.  That represents 64,000 more sales than a year ago, and remember, these numbers only represent the automakers that report sales monthly.

Toyota RAV4 edged out the Honda CR-V, but CR-V has some momentum with sales up last month 52%, while the RAV4 was virtually flat.  For the year, the RAV4 has a 28,000-unit lead over CR-V so I don’t see the CR-V overtaking RAV4 for the year, although it will likely be a closer race than years past.  The Ford Bronco Sport and Ford Bronco moved up to the 5th and 6th position.

On the bottom of the list is the Mazda MX-30, Mazda’s failed first attempt at an all-electric.  Next to the bottom is the Hyundai Nexo fuel cell vehicle, in spite of 0% for 72 months, discounts of $30,000 (yes, $30,000) a $15,000 pre-paid credit card for fuel, and the $7,500 Federal Tax Credit.
